Handover for the weekly eng sync: I'm transferring ownership of Duskrunner, our nightly backfill scheduler, to Priya. Current state: all jobs healthy except the ledger-reconciliation backfill, which retries once nightly due to a slow upstream from the Kestwick warehouse. Retry logic, window sizing, and concurrency caps were all tuned carefully last quarter — please don't change them without a load test. For full transparency at the sync, the production instance runs with these configuration values.

settings of hawep-kadug:
RALAEL_HOST=ralael.tolvaqlabs.internal
RALAEL_PORT=9000

## Getting Started with Dusklight Backfills

Welcome aboard! Dusklight is our nightly backfill scheduler, and your plugin hooks into it via the `on_window_ready` callback. Each night it slices the previous day into hourly windows and hands them to registered plugins in dependency order. Keep handlers idempotent — reruns happen more often than you'd think. Sandbox credentials are provisioned when your plugin is approved. The full plugin API reference and example repo live on the internal page below.

wiki page, bagaf-fawip: https://harbor.tolvaqsys.local/pages/repo/pages/secrets/eac969ffc71f356b

# Welcome aboard! This module powers the scaling math for PanPal's
# recipe calculator. Short version: we scale ingredient quantities by
# a ratio, then round to "kitchen-friendly" fractions so nobody sees
# 0.3337 cups. Rounding granularity and the max scale factor live in
# constants so QA can tweak them without a deploy. Current values are
# as follows.

tuning table, faduf-baduf:
PRIORITIES = {
    "ulavan": 191,
    "silys": 750,
    "goriel": 238,
    "kelmir": 66,
    "wendor": 432,
}

## Franchise Agreement — Harbrook Coffee Co. (Managers Only)

Quick heads-up for all branch managers: the renewed franchise agreement with Marlow & Dent takes effect next quarter. Royalty tiers are shifting slightly, and the marketing co-op fund now covers local signage. Don't promise anything to prospective sub-franchisees until legal signs off — a few clauses are still in flux. Training on the new terms happens at the Tillford regional session. The strategic rationale is summarized below.

management briefing: The renewal with Zoraelax Group closes at $10 million a year, 15 percent below the last contract. Project Ralael slips by six weeks because of the audit delay.